#413373 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#413373 is composed of 25.5% red, 20%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.5% cyan, 55.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 253.1 degrees, a saturation of 38.6% and a lightness of 32.5%. #413373 color hex could be obtained by blending #8266e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#413373 color description : Dark moderate blue.

#413373 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#413373 has RGB values of R:65, G:51,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4273011.

Shades and Tints of #413373

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040306 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#413373

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535353 is the less saturated color, while #2806a0 is the most saturated one.
